#172fdb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#172fdb is composed of 9% red, 18.4%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 232.7 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 47.5%. #172fdb color hex could be obtained by blending #2e5eff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#172fdb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010106 is the darkest color, while #f3f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#172fdb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74757e is the less saturated color, while #0421ee is the most saturated one.
